    I can't believe I attended UHWO for about 4 months, and only now did I decide to check out Da Spot located on campus in the cafeteria area (Building C first level). This is the only food vendor on campus and I hope they'll expand to have other vendors soon! I've always snacked using the vending machines or drove off campus to get some lunch. I am writing this review mainly because of their acai bowl... ughhhhh the mixed feelings I have for this place. First off, 5 STARS for their acai bowl! I am still shocked and amazed that a huge bowl (seems to me that it's 24oz but I could be wrong) is only $6!! I tried their acai bowl before at the King Street location, but that was such a long time ago. They give you the option to choose between apple juice or soymilk base for the acai bowl, and I specifically remember choosing soymilk because I LOVE SOYMILK. It's a unique twist and the color of the acai is lighter and pretty - presentation of the acai bowl with bananas, strawberries, and granola looked appealing too! My only concern was that I had a huge frozen strawberry that didn't get blended in well with the acai. Nonetheless, I would definitely order this again from now on when I'm on campus. I love acai bowls too! FOOD - Other than the acai bowl, I've also tried the grand slam sand and breakfast bowls. The grand slam sand is a bagel/croissant sandwich (your choice of bread) with eggs, a choice of meat, pesto sauce, and cheese. They didn't ask what bread I wanted but it's whatever because I didn't know how to order at the time lol, but I got my sandwich on a bagel and it was so good! Highly recommend. Breakfast bowl? Not so much. The taste was great with a lot of flavors, only if you like veggies (red and green onions, tomatoes/bell peppers, etc) with scrambled eggs on rice. I lost my appetite though because my eggs weren't cooked properly, and I was afraid and unfortunate that this would happen. SERVICE - It's super weird like anyone could probably walk away with the food without paying. I was so confused.. But from experiencing the process, you order your food/drinks first at the food counter and while they're cooking the food for you, you go to the register to pay BUT that's only if there's a cashier there to ring you up, which most of the time there isn't and you're left there standing and waiting for a few minutes. Because of this experience, I'm giving Da Spot UHWO an overall 3 stars.

    Da Spot gets five stars because of the smoothies! The smoothies are made right there with lots of different options to choose from, and if you don't like the options, you can have your smoothie made to your taste. There are a variety of fruits (strawberry, banana, coconut, pineapple, mixed berries, etc), sorbets (lilikoi, lychee, guava, etc), and liquids (soy milk, passion orange juice, guava juice, etc). And the smoothies are pretty cheap: $3 for 16-oz, $3.50 for 20-oz, and $5 for 32-oz. What a deal! Way cheaper than Jamba Juice. The food is pretty good too. The pre-made food is typically $6 for mini and $8 for regular with main dish, rice, and salad. Some friends got chicken parmesan, which was delicious when I sampled. There are also more typical concession foods like burgers and pizzas. I ordered fish and chips. Pretty sure the fish is frozen and fried, and that's the quality you get. Not the best I've had by far, but still satisfying. The service is actually really good! All of the workers I interacted with in the two times I've eaten at Da Spot were all really nice. They talk stories with you and help you out with what you need. Excited that when I'm at UH West Oahu there's a good food choice on campus.
